Titans Game Worn Helmet signed by a couple random players (Blaine Bishop, Chris Sanders) - #78 sticker is inside helmet but there is no 3 digit letter code on the facemask, so I'm having difficulty assigning a date to the helmet.
Tom, you probably (well definitely) know a lot more about this than I do...here's a scan of what's on the facemask. I've never seen the "12-06K" coding...does that mean 12/2006 or what would that indicate, and is there another way to date the helmet if this code doesn't mean anything?
Preston, another nice looking Titans helmet. I sent a question to Riddell re the date code. I believe Ti is for titantium and that it was manufactured Dec 2006 - the "K" I do not know.
I have a William Hayes # 95 Titan gamer. Also a Riddell Revolution lid. The Riddell mask date code is "Riddell 02-11 C". Has the "Meets NOCSAE Standard" underneath and then a "Pat. No. 7,036,151".
With you facing the helmet - left side - the aforementioned is printed on the top bar - inside on the bar. On the top bar - left side - printed inside is the number 74912.
The helmet was manufactured Feb 2011.
My helmet manufacture date and face mask date match it appears.
